Year : 
2020
Title : 
Biology
Exam : 
WASSCE/WAEC MAY/JUNE

Paper 1 | Objectives

11 - 20 of 50 Questions

# Question Ans
11.

Which of the following tissues does not provide support in flowering plants?

A. Collenchyma

B. Parenchyma

C. Xylem

D. Phloem

B

14.

The respiratory organ of a cockroach

A. air sac

B. trachea

C. lung book

D. lung

B

15.

The excretory product of some reptiles, birds and insects is

A. urea

B. urine

C. ammonia

D. uric acid

D

16.

The part of the mammalian kidney that stores urine is the

A. capsule

B. medulla

C. pelvis

D. bladder

D

17.

The properties of endocrine system include the following except

A. secretion of hormones

B. transportation by blood to target organ

C. having specific effect

D. release of secretion into ducts

D
